US10397019B2 · Polysync Technologies Inc · Source: google-patentsIn embodiments of an autonomous vehicle platform and safety architecture, safety managers of a safety-critical system monitor outputs of linked components of the safety-critical system. The linked components comprise at least three components, each of which is configured to produce output indicative of a same event independent from the other linked components by using different input information than the other linked components. The safety managers also compare the outputs of the linked components to determine whether each output indicates the occurrence of a same event. When the output of one linked component does not indicate the occurrence of an event that is indicated by the outputs of the other linked components, the safety managers identify the one linked component as having failed. Based on this, the outputs of the other linked components are used to carry out operations of the safety-critical system without using the output of the failed component.

A first request for content is sent to a network content server. A response protocol header is received indicating that a payment is sought for the content in response to the first request. Payment manager code integral to a browser or a browser plug-in is executed in response to receiving the response protocol header. A payment-signifying token is received from a payment provider in response to consummating the payment. A second request for the content is sent to the network content server, where the second request includes a request protocol header specifying the payment-signifying token.

US10373610B2 · Baidu USA LLC · Source: google-patentsDescribed herein are systems and methods for automatic unit selection and target decomposition for sequence labelling. Embodiments include a new loss function called Gram-Connectionist Temporal Classification (CTC) loss that extend the popular CTC loss function criterion to alleviate prior limitations. While preserving the advantages of CTC, Gram-CTC automatically learns the best set of basic units (grams), as well as the most suitable decomposition of target sequences. Unlike CTC, embodiments of Gram-CTC allow a model to output variable number of characters at each time step, which enables the model to capture longer term dependency and improves the computational efficiency. It is also demonstrated that embodiments of Gram-CTC improve CTC in terms of both performance and efficiency on the large vocabulary speech recognition task at multiple scales of data, and that systems that employ an embodiment of Gram-CTC can outperform the state-of-the-art on a standard speech benchmark.
